    Highland Chateau Health And Rehabilitation Center — Overview

    The data profile for this Special Focus Facility reflects high staff turnover, a heavy reliance on contract labor, and a federal fine history that exceeds state averages.

    Located at 2319 WEST SEVENTH STREET, SAINT PAUL, MN 55116. 64-bed for profit - limited liability company nursing facility.
